Dickens and the Unreal City : Searching for Spiritual Significance in Nineteenth-Century London PDF
by K. Smith
Description
Dickens's London often acts as a complex symbol, composed of numerous sub-symbols, such as crowd, river, railway networks and police systems.
This book is particularly interested in how Dickens's treatment of the city allows him to re-examine traditional Christian discourses on the issues of revelation, renunciation and regeneration.
